Compare all specifications:
2008 Chrysler PT Cruiser | 2005 Suzuki XL7 | |
Make | Chrysler | Suzuki |
Model | PT Cruiser | XL7 |
Year Released | 2008 | 2005 |
Body Type | Hatchback | SUV |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2148 cc | 2737 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 149 HP | 185 HP |
Engine RPM | 4000 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 300 Nm | 250 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 88 mm | 88 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 88.3 mm | 75 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 18.0:1 | 9.5:1 |
Drive Type | Front | 4WD |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 7 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1558 kg | 1735 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4290 mm | 4770 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1750 mm | 1790 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1670 mm | 1750 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2620 mm | 2810 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 6.7 L/100km | 12.4 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 57 L | 64 L |
